臥式磨床市場:分析範圍

臥式磨床對於處理木材、廢物和有機廢物等大量材料至關重要,並且在破碎、粉碎和回收應用中表現出色。臥式磨床市場面向建築、採礦、廢棄物管理和林業等行業,提供可提高效率並降低營運成本的高容量機器。市場成長的動力來自於減少廢棄物的需求增加、粉碎技術的進步以及對永續回收解決方案的需求。

市場成長動力:

全球臥式磨床市場受到多種關鍵因素的推動,例如越來越關注廢棄物管理和永續實踐。各行各業越來越多地使用臥式磨床來高效處理廢物,有助於減少垃圾掩埋場廢物並增加回收利用。技術進步,例如更耐用、更節能的機械的開發,正在提高生產力並降低維護成本,從而推動市場成長。此外,全球建築和採礦活動的擴張進一步推動了對臥式磨床的需求,因為它們對於這些行業的材料加工至關重要。

市場限制:

儘管成長前景看好,但臥式磨床市場面臨高前期成本和維護要求相關的課題。臥式磨床的高昂購買和營運成本可能會阻礙中小企業對此類設備的投資,特別是在預算限制更為明顯的發展中地區。此外,機器操作的複雜性以及對操作這些機器的熟練勞動力的需求構成了進一步的障礙,限制了某些地區的市場採用。

市場機會:

由於技術進步、環境法規和基礎設施發展,臥式磨床市場提供了巨大的成長機會。物聯網和人工智慧技術的整合等自動化技術的進步為提高臥式磨床的效率和安全性提供了新的機會。此外,對生物能源和生物質可持續燃料生產的需求不斷增加,預計將為市場參與者提供重大機會。投資研發生產環保、經濟、節能的磨床將是開拓新興市場、維持長期成長的關鍵。

Horizontal Grinders Market - Report Scope:

Horizontal grinders are essential for processing large quantities of materials such as wood, waste, and organic debris, offering superior performance in grinding, shredding, and recycling applications. The horizontal grinder market caters to industries such as construction, mining, waste management, and forestry, providing high-capacity machines that enhance efficiency and reduce operational costs. Market growth is driven by increasing demand for waste reduction, advancements in grinding technologies, and the need for sustainable recycling solutions.

Market Growth Drivers:

The global horizontal grinders market is propelled by several key factors, including the growing emphasis on waste management and sustainable practices. Industries are increasingly adopting horizontal grinders to process waste materials efficiently, contributing to the reduction of landfill waste and promoting recycling. Technological advancements, such as the development of more durable and energy-efficient machines, are enhancing productivity and lowering maintenance costs, thus driving market growth. Additionally, the expansion of construction and mining activities worldwide is further contributing to the demand for horizontal grinders as they are essential in processing materials in these industries.

Market Restraints:

Despite promising growth prospects, the horizontal grinders market faces challenges related to high initial costs and maintenance requirements. The high purchase price and operational costs of horizontal grinders may deter small and medium-sized enterprises from investing in such equipment, particularly in developing regions where budget constraints are more pronounced. Furthermore, the complexity of machine operations and the need for skilled labor to operate these machines pose additional barriers, limiting market adoption in certain regions.

Market Opportunities:

The horizontal grinders market presents significant growth opportunities driven by technological innovations, environmental regulations, and infrastructure development. Advances in automation, such as the integration of IoT and AI technologies, offer new opportunities for improving the efficiency and safety of horizontal grinders. Additionally, the increasing demand for bioenergy and sustainable fuel production from biomass is expected to provide substantial opportunities for market players. Investment in R&D to create eco-friendly, cost-effective, and energy-efficient grinders will be key to tapping into emerging markets and sustaining long-term growth.

Competitive Intelligence and Business Strategy:

Leading players in the global horizontal grinders market, including Vermeer Corporation, Terex Corporation, and Bandit Industries, focus on innovation, product differentiation, and strategic partnerships to gain a competitive edge. These companies invest in R&D to develop advanced grinding solutions, such as electric-powered machines, mobile units, and machines designed for specific applications, catering to diverse industry needs. Collaborations with suppliers, distributors, and end-users help these companies to expand their market reach and improve product offerings.
